Output d61866235cfd8c39f1a51ac37982bb16b342d067ded67fbfc4e55f6bf89eaad8:35

value
7908000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65ca2936f12eda11a441f607e6fc7cb26656b05 OP_EQUAL
address
3METVzWkmEmJDLWaj8D4G5XvTu9HYcvjVG
transaction
d61866235cfd8c39f1a51ac37982bb16b342d067ded67fbfc4e55f6bf89eaad8
spent
true